Davis Scott


(From Clark Funeral Home)

Davis Quinton Scott, age 78, of Neosho, entered into rest on January 15, 2022, in the comfort of his home, surrounded by his loving family. 

Davis was born September 12, 1943, in Neosho, to the late Oliver Quinton and Mary M. (Shepard) Scott. He was a lifelong area resident and graduate of Neosho High School. 










He worked as a carpenter and then owned and operated, Scott’s Boot and Tack and was a horseshoer. He enjoyed attending Rodeos and roping and was a member of the Burkhart Church of Christ. 

Davis and Cynthia Ruth McCrary were married on November 1, 1964, and she preceded him in death on July 29, 1992. 

He is survived by three children, Tim (Jody) Davis of Anderson, Missouri, Stacia Scott of Neosho, Missouri and Katie Scott of Paradise, Texas; grandchildren, Chaney Scott, Bailey Scott, Wacey Henderson, Kye Rieff and Hunter Davis; great grandchildren, Katie Bell Williams, Louis Kalvin Henderson, Lizzy Paige Rieff and Tryan Davis Rieff; three sisters, Dale Williams, Rilla Scott, and Rosemary Landes; one brother, Edward Scott and partner, Sharon Rodney. 

Graveside services will be Wednesday, January 19, 2022, at 10 am at the Burkhart Cemetery, John Anderson will officiate. 

Those serving as pallbearers are Justin Martin, Kye Rieff, Hunter Scott and Bailey Scott. 

The family will receive friends at a time of visitation, Tuesday evening, January 18, 2022, from 5:30 to 7 pm at the Clark Funeral Home, Neosho.
